access-list hardware region

access-list hardware region
To modify the balance between TCAM regions in hardware, use the access-list hardware region
command.

Defaults
The default region balance for each TCAM is 50.
Command Modes
Global configuration mode
Command History
Release
12.2(31)SG
Usage Guidelines
PandV is a TCAM region containing entries which mask in both the port and VLAN tag portions of the
flow label.
PorV is a TCAM region containing entries which mask in either the port or VLAN tag portion of the
flow label, but not both.
A balance of 1 allocates the minimum number of PandV region entries and the maximum number of
PorV region entries. A balance of 99 allocates the maximum number of PandV region entries and the
minimum number of PorV region entries. A balance of 50 allocates equal numbers of PandV and PorV
region entries in the specified TCAM.
Balances for the four TCAMs can be modified independently.

access-list hardware region {feature | qos} {input | output} balance {bal-num}
Specifies adjustment of region balance for ACLs.
Specifies adjustment of region balance for QoS.
Specifies adjustment of region balance for input ACL and QoS.
Specifies adjustment of region balance for output ACL and QoS.
Specifies relative sizes of the PandV and PorV regions in the TCAM; valid
values are between 1 and 99.
